Hallo,

I used the R rawcopy package to analyze my affymetrix SNP 6.0 data. This produced the segmentation and the log ratios and allelic imbalance values. Now I'm trying to analyze those, but I can't find a suitable way. I tried the packages that are stated in the rawcopy paper for further analysis and failed to apply any of them. This was mainly because all of them have practical no useful documentation. Or at least I didn't find one. Right now I started trying to calculate the gains and losses with a simple threshold method myself, but even this is tricky because I'm not sure if I use the correct outputs from rawcopy... If anyone has experience with the rawcopy output and its further usage, I would be extremely happy to get some advice.

Hi Moritz,

I'll try to answer you with my (little) experience with rawcopy (and after some emails with the package's author, he's very kind):

  • The correct output, I guess you mean the segmentation output, is the segments.txt file (the other ones are for generating the different plots for the QC).
  • A possible method for establishing a threshold could be those contained within GISTIC2... it performs a double-step procedure: 1) it calculates a significance according the entire genome as background (this'd be the value you're searching) and 2) it searches for recurrent alterations among all your samples and gives them a score.
  • And finally, after some (and not so difficult) code, you can use copynumber package for plotting (and additional segmentation if you don't like rawcopy's one.

I hope these tips help you a bit. Feel free to ask whatever you want. Bests.
